Kadam is a Rural village located in Sadar, Kalahandi, Odisha.
The total population of Kadam is 118.
Kadam village comprises 32 households.
The literacy rate in Kadam is 39.6%. Among the literate population of 40, there are 24 literate males and 16 literate females.
In Kadam, there are 54 males and 64 females, with a sex ratio of 1185 females per 1000 males.
There are 17 children (14.4% of population), comprising 8 boys and 9 girls.
The total number of workers in Kadam is 56, with 9 main workers and 47 marginal workers.
In Kadam, there are 19 people belonging to Scheduled Castes (10 males, 9 females) and 4 people belonging to Scheduled Tribes (1 males, 3 females).
Kadam is located in Odisha state, Kalahandi district, and falls under Sadar Tehsil. The village's Census 2011 code is 423362 and LGD code is 423362.
